Accident Classification: Powered Haulage
Location: MCGREGOR - Flathead County, MT
Mine Controller: Brad Mercord; Bill Carter
Mine Type: Surface
Mined Material: Dimension Stone NEC
Incident Date/Time: October 19, 2018 03:00 pm

PRELIMINARY REPORT

A quarry manager was operating a 30-ton Volvo haul truck when he was fatally injured. The victim was moving the haul truck down a steep grade, around a turn, when the haul truck traveled through a bermand off a short drop-off. The victim was found several hours later by the owner of the company in the haul truck. The victim was not wearing a seat belt

FATALITY ALERT

METAL/NONMETAL MINE FATALITY – On October 19, 2018, a 63-year old quarry manager, with 17 years of experience, was fatally injured when he lost control of the haul truck he was driving.  The victim was operating a haul truck down a steep grade and traveled through a berm and over a short drop-off.  The victim was not wearing a seat belt.
